Abstract

This study aims to analyze the role of Human Resource Management (HRM) in implementing Occupational Health and Safety (OHS) in the workplace through a literature review approach. The research was conducted by examining various scientific sources related to OHS policies, safety training, internal supervision, and safety culture development. The findings indicate that HRM plays a strategic role in the successful implementation of OHS through the formulation of safety policies, the provision of continuous training, monitoring compliance with standard operating procedures, and the development of a strong safety culture. Previous studies show that a well-structured OHS system can significantly reduce workplace accidents. Additionally, managerial commitment, worker involvement, and the availability of safety facilities are key factors influencing the effectiveness of OHS implementation. This study emphasizes that the success of OHS is not solely determined by regulatory compliance but also by the active role of HRM in managing workers’ behavior, knowledge, and adherence to safety procedures. Therefore, HRM must develop sustainable and adaptive safety strategies to enhance workplace safety comprehensively.

Abstract

The habit of saving from an early age is an important foundation for building financial literacy. This community service program aims to instill an understanding of saving through a creative approach at SD Negeri 15 Nusa Indah, Bengkulu City. The method used combines the presentation of the concept of saving with the practice of recycling used bottles into functional piggy banks. The activity took place in a series of interactive sessions involving the active participation of all students. Evaluation results showed an increase in the understanding of the concept of saving and participants' enthusiasm for managing their personal finances. This project-based learning approach is proven to be effective not only instilling the habit of saving but also fostering creativity and environmental awareness. This program has successfully created a sustainable impact in developing a thrifty and financially savvy character in students.

Abstract

This study analyzes the relationship between job satisfaction and employee performance through a literature review of publications from the last ten years (2015–2024). The review results indicate that job satisfaction has a positive impact on performance, both on task performance and extra-role behavior. This relationship is also influenced by factors such as motivation, organizational commitment, and leadership style. In addition to finding consistency in empirical findings, the study identifies a research gap in methodologies still dominated by quantitative methods and the limited sectors studied. This study provides a theoretical basis for the development of further research and human resource management practices.

Abstract

This study aims to examine whether casualties arising from outing class activities both fatalities and victims experiencing physical or psychological trauma can be categorized as unlawful acts. It also seeks to identify the legal remedies available to victims and their families as the disadvantaged parties in holding the responsible institution accountable for material and immaterial losses. Although outing class activities are intended to enhance students’ creativity, skills, and learning experiences through outdoor learning, they have increasingly received negative public stigma when such activities result in tragedies causing loss of life. These incidents raise parental concerns regarding student safety, prompting victims and their families to pursue legal measures as a form of protection and to ensure equal treatment before the law. This research employs a normative juridical approach, examining legal provisions, norms, and doctrines relevant to the issues addressed. The study concludes that the actions of the school can be classified as unlawful acts when assessed against the established legal elements and the facts of the incident. Consequently, the school bears legal responsibility for the harm caused by the negligence of its employees, particularly teachers, in organizing outing class activities. Accountability includes providing compensation for both material and immaterial damages suffered by the victims.

Abstract

This study analyzes the transformation of K3 in Indonesia from an administrative obligation to a strategic element to support a creative work environment. Through a systematic review (PRISMA 2020) of 15 out of 450 articles, this study revealed three key findings: (1) K3 creates psychological safety as a psychological foundation; (2) K3 increases motivation and job satisfaction; and (3) K3 encourages organizational innovation through employee participation. In conclusion, K3 is a strategic investment for organizational competitiveness that needs to be integrated into HR strategies. Recommendations for further research are longitudinal empirical studies.

Abstract

This research aims to explore how companies included in the LQ45 index disclose social aspects within the Environmental, Social, and Governance (ESG) framework in their 2024 sustainability reports. Through document analysis of Sustainability Reports and supporting literature, this study maps the quality and comprehensiveness of disclosures based on GRI 401–406 social indicators. The results show disparities between sectors: companies in the mining, energy, and banking sectors have more detailed disclosures, particularly on employment and occupational safety aspects, while the FMCG, property, and technology sectors still show limited disclosures, particularly on issues of diversity, industrial relations, and anti-discrimination

Abstract

Organizations knowledge and teamwork strategy to achieve organizational success is important for the younger generation. Various methods can be used to convey this material, one of which is using games. The purpose of this training is delivering material on organizational success factors to haigh school students at the Islamic Boarding School, Al Fatimiyah Lamongan. Water estafet game develop to train softskill students with more interesting methode. The training was conducted using the ADDIE instructional development model, which includes the stages of Analyze, Design, Develop, Implementation, and Evaluation. The water estafet game was carried out in groups and aimed to complete two missions: answering questions and replacing cloudy water with clean water. Each group competed to complete the game and then jointly identified factors that influenced their success. Each participant reflected on the importance of these factors in achieving organizational success. The activity was attended cheerfully and enthusiastically.

Abstract

This study aims to model the daily return volatility of Bank Syariah Indonesia (BSI) in order to understand the characteristics of investment risk in the Islamic banking sector following the merger. Given that financial data often exhibit heteroskedasticity (non-constant variance) and volatility clustering, the use of standard linear models tends to produce biased results. To address this, the study employs Autoregressive Conditional Heteroskedasticity (ARCH) and Generalized ARCH (GARCH) methods, utilizing 948 daily log-return observations. The analytical procedures include the Augmented Dickey-Fuller (ADF) stationarity test, the ARCH effect test, and model selection based on information criteria. The findings indicate that BSI stock returns are stationary at the level form. Diagnostic testing confirms the presence of ARCH effects. Based on the Log Likelihood and Akaike Information Criterion (AIC), the GARCH(1,1) model is identified as the best-fitting specification compared to ARCH(1) and GARCH(1,1)-MA. Parameter estimation reveals a high degree of volatility persistence (α+β=0.92), suggesting that market shocks exert long-term effects on the risk profile of BSI stock.

Abstract

This study analyzes the compliance of Occupational Safety and Health (OSH) implementation at PT Aneka Tambang Tbk, a state-owned mining company, using Government Regulation No. 50 of 2012 on the Occupational Safety and Health Management System (SMK3) as the analytical framework. Employing a descriptive qualitative approach through literature review, data were drawn from legislation, PT ANTAM’s annual and sustainability reports, and relevant scholarly works on mining OSH and Human Resource Management (HRM). The findings show that PT ANTAM demonstrates strong compliance with SMK3, reflected in clear OSH policies, structured risk control systems, continuous training, safety audits, and occupational health programs supporting workers’ well-being. The implementation contributes to fulfilling workers’ rights and highlights corporate responsibility from an HRM perspective. The study concludes that compliance analysis based on literature review is effective for assessing SMK3 implementation and serves as a foundation for strengthening safety culture in the mining sector

Abstract

This community service activity aims to provide understanding and education on stunting prevention efforts, starting during pregnancy, by strengthening the role of families and Posyandu (Integrated Service Post) cadres. This community service activity utilizes a nutrition education intervention design with a participatory approach. The target group is 35 pregnant women, 35 accompanying family members (fathers or grandmothers), and 35 Posyandu cadres in Semen village in 2025. Results indicate that nutrition education has proven effective in improving family knowledge, attitudes, and support for stunting prevention. The success of the intervention is influenced by the active involvement of families, especially fathers, as well as strengthening the capacity of Posyandu cadres as agents of change at the community level. Conclusion: Family-based nutrition education and Posyandu cadres are effective in strengthening stunting prevention efforts in pregnant women. This program is recommended for sustainable integration into routine Posyandu activities.
